Output 98b842ed3589e5618b98c19cdfca4b19a522ecfd63de35b3efa793028a4fb996:2

value
72698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e89b063df3c5f50ba905259ec94ca37e92b92ece OP_EQUAL
address
3NtvQLAxTZpGDr3ms9vuMwXzWsyr6Fvdww
transaction
98b842ed3589e5618b98c19cdfca4b19a522ecfd63de35b3efa793028a4fb996
confirmations
122917
spent
true